Why School Transport Monitoring Became More Important in India

Indian cities have become significantly more crowded over the last few years.

Longer travel distances, unpredictable traffic congestion, construction zones, weather disruptions, and changing school timings have increased the complexity of daily school transportation.

For parents, uncertainty creates stress.

Particularly for:

  • Working parents managing office schedules
  • Families in metro cities with long commute times
  • Parents of younger children
  • Schools operating multiple routes across large urban areas

This is where real-time school bus tracking changes the experience.

Instead of depending on assumptions, parents receive live location visibility and timely movement updates directly through mobile platforms.

That small shift creates a major psychological difference.

The bus journey no longer feels invisible.

Parents No Longer Want “Updates”. They Want Visibility.

Traditional transport communication systems relied heavily on reactive coordination.

A parent would call only after noticing a delay. The transport team would then contact the driver for updates. Information moved slowly, and frustration increased quickly.

Live GPS systems solve that problem differently.

They create proactive visibility.

Parents can:

  • Check the bus location in real time
  • Estimate arrival timings more accurately
  • Reduce unnecessary waiting outside homes or bus stops
  • Receive alerts for delays or route movement
  • Feel more informed during the entire journey

This is one reason why real-time school bus tracking is increasingly becoming part of school admission conversations as well.

Parents now evaluate transportation experience as part of the overall school infrastructure.

Not just academics.

The Operational Benefits Matter for Schools Too

The conversation is often framed around parents, but schools also face growing transportation management challenges.

Managing multiple buses manually becomes difficult when:

  • Routes overlap
  • Traffic patterns change unexpectedly
  • Drivers miss checkpoints
  • Communication gaps occur
  • Pickup timings shift frequently

Without central visibility, transport coordination becomes reactive instead of structured.

Schools using digital tracking systems can improve operational monitoring through:

  • Centralised route visibility
  • Better coordination between transport staff and drivers
  • Faster response during delays
  • Improved pickup and drop scheduling
  • Reduced dependency on manual follow-ups

Over time, this creates a more organised transport ecosystem for both administrators and parents.

1. What is real time school bus tracking?

Real time school bus tracking is a GPS-enabled transport monitoring system that allows schools and parents to view the live location of school buses during pickup and drop operations. It helps improve visibility, communication, and transport coordination.

2. Why are parents demanding live school bus tracking in India?

Parents today expect more transparency around student transportation because daily commute conditions in Indian cities have become less predictable. Real time visibility helps reduce uncertainty related to delays, route changes, and arrival timings.

3. How does real time school bus tracking help schools?

Schools can manage transport operations more efficiently through better route visibility, faster delay handling, improved coordination with drivers, and reduced dependency on manual communication workflows.

4. Is school bus tracking only useful for large schools?

No. Even schools with smaller transport networks can benefit from improved communication and operational visibility. As parent expectations continue increasing, transport transparency is becoming important across schools of different sizes.
